Eel metaphors have been with us as long as we've been eating eels -- so a long time. The ancient Greeks certainly had their share. In his play "The Knights" Aristophanes (d.386 BCE) compares demagogues to eel fishermen who had to muddy the waters before they could make a profit. 🗃️🧪

Buying redemption w/ eels wasn't just a medieval English thing. Oh, no! In 1500 the Duke of Ferarra wanted nuns in Florence to pray for him. But that kinda thing ain't free, & to get his prayers the duke had to make regular payments of eels to the sisters. Soul food, y'all.

Maybe the fanciest medieval eel recipe was the French "reversed eel." How do you make it? Well... First, you skin & debone the eel. Then, sew it back together inside out, stuffed with bread crumbs, meats & spices. Then, cook it in red wine. Kind of a super-fancy eel hot pocket! 🗃️🧪

We all change in appearance as we age. Even eels! For most of their lives, living in fresh water, they're yellowish-brown. It helps them blend into the mud. But as they prepare to migrate back to sea to mate & die, they become silver in color. Just like the rest of us. 🗃️🧪
